Node.js组件实现视频持续上传至Onecloud平台

需积分: 9 0 下载量 103 浏览量 更新于2024-12-12 收藏 2KB ZIP 举报
资源摘要信息: "onecloud-video-upload.js是一个基于Node.js开发的组件,专为持续上传视频到OneCloud视频平台设计。它允许用户或应用程序通过Node.js环境实现与OneCloud平台的视频上传交互。OneCloud视频平台是一个云服务提供商,它提供视频存储和流媒体服务,使得用户可以高效地上传和管理视频内容。借助JavaScript,开发者可以轻松集成onecloud-video-upload.js到自己的应用或服务中,为用户提供便捷的视频上传功能。 描述中提到的“设计”一词暗示了onecloud-video-upload.js组件的开发经过了精心的设计过程,尽管详细的设计信息未在描述中给出,但可以推测该组件可能具备良好的模块化、易于配置和扩展以及可能拥有详细的文档说明,以方便开发者理解和集成。 该组件的主要功能是对视频文件进行持续上传。这通常意味着组件支持断点续传、分片上传或大文件上传机制,这些机制在上传大文件或在上传过程中可能出现网络中断时尤其重要。这样,即便上传过程中出现问题,用户也不需要从头开始上传整个视频文件,从而提高了上传效率和用户体验。 JavaScript标签表明该组件是用JavaScript编程语言实现的。Node.js是基于Chrome V8引擎的JavaScript运行环境,它允许开发者使用JavaScript编写服务器端应用程序。Node.js的异步非阻塞I/O模型使得它特别适合处理高并发的I/O操作,如文件上传,这使得onecloud-video-upload.js成为构建高性能视频上传服务的理想选择。 文件名称列表中提到了"onecloud-video-upload.js-master",表明该组件的源代码可能托管在某个版本控制系统(如Git)上,并使用了"master"作为默认分支。这说明组件可能被频繁更新和维护,并且开发者可以从源代码仓库中获取最新的代码和功能。 使用onecloud-video-upload.js组件,开发者可以按照OneCloud视频平台的API规范,实现视频的上传、更新、删除等操作。组件可能提供了丰富的API接口,使得开发者可以通过简单的配置即可实现视频的上传流程。此外,组件也可能支持回调函数或Promise模式,允许开发者在上传过程中加入自定义的处理逻辑,如上传进度反馈、上传成功或失败的处理等。 在使用该组件时,开发者需要注意OneCloud视频平台的相关使用条款和政策,例如视频的存储空间限制、上传速率限制、费用以及安全性要求等。同时,对于视频内容的版权和隐私保护也是开发过程中需要考虑的重要方面。 总之,onecloud-video-upload.js为开发者提供了一个便捷的途径,通过Node.js环境实现与OneCloud视频平台的集成,进行视频的持续上传和管理。随着互联网视频应用的快速发展,这类组件对于开发视频内容驱动的应用和服务具有重要的作用。"